在当今这个信息爆炸的时代,物流行业正经历着前所未有的变革。智慧物流,作为物流行业与互联网、大数据、人工智能等前沿技术的深度融合,正逐渐成为推动行业发展的新引擎。本文将带您深入了解大模型在智慧物流中的应用,以及最新智能物流技术的突破。
大模型在智慧物流中的应用
1. 货物追踪与路径优化
大模型在货物追踪与路径优化方面发挥着重要作用。通过分析海量历史数据,大模型能够预测货物在运输过程中的可能风险,并实时调整运输路线,从而提高物流效率。以下是一个简单的货物追踪与路径优化示例:
# 假设有一个货物从A地运往B地,我们需要根据实时路况优化路径
import requests
def get_traffic_data():
# 获取实时路况数据
response = requests.get('http://trafficapi.com/get_traffic_data')
return response.json()
def optimize_route(traffic_data):
# 根据实时路况优化路径
best_route = 'A -> C -> B'
return best_route
traffic_data = get_traffic_data()
best_route = optimize_route(traffic_data)
print('最佳路径:', best_route)
2. 仓储管理
大模型在仓储管理中的应用同样广泛。通过分析仓库内货物的存储、出入库等数据,大模型能够预测货物需求,优化库存管理,降低仓储成本。以下是一个简单的仓储管理示例:
# 假设有一个仓库,我们需要根据历史数据预测货物需求,优化库存管理
import pandas as pd
def predict_demand(data):
# 预测货物需求
demand = data['demand'].mean()
return demand
def optimize_inventory(data, demand):
# 根据需求优化库存
inventory = data['inventory'].mean()
if demand > inventory:
print('需要补充库存')
else:
print('库存充足')
data = pd.read_csv('warehouse_data.csv')
demand = predict_demand(data)
optimize_inventory(data, demand)
3. 供应链协同
大模型在供应链协同方面也具有显著优势。通过整合供应链上下游企业的数据,大模型能够实现信息共享、协同作业,提高整个供应链的运作效率。以下是一个简单的供应链协同示例:
# 假设有一个供应链,我们需要根据上下游企业的数据实现信息共享
def share_information(producer_data, distributor_data):
# 实现信息共享
shared_data = {'producer': producer_data, 'distributor': distributor_data}
return shared_data
producer_data = {'product': 'A', 'quantity': 100}
distributor_data = {'product': 'A', 'quantity': 200}
shared_data = share_information(producer_data, distributor_data)
print('共享数据:', shared_data)
最新智能物流技术突破
1. 自动驾驶技术
自动驾驶技术在物流领域的应用越来越广泛。通过搭载先进传感器和人工智能算法,自动驾驶车辆能够实现自主导航、避障、装卸货物等功能,提高物流运输效率。以下是一个简单的自动驾驶车辆示例:
# 假设有一辆自动驾驶车辆,我们需要实现自主导航、避障、装卸货物等功能
class AutonomousVehicle:
def __init__(self):
self.sensor = Sensor()
self.navigation = Navigation()
self.lifting = Lifting()
def navigate(self):
# 实现自主导航
path = self.navigation.get_path()
return path
def avoid_obstacles(self):
# 实现避障
obstacles = self.sensor.detect_obstacles()
for obstacle in obstacles:
self.navigation.avoid(obstacle)
return obstacles
def lift_goods(self):
# 实现装卸货物
self.lifting.load()
self.lifting.unload()
vehicle = AutonomousVehicle()
path = vehicle.navigate()
obstacles = vehicle.avoid_obstacles()
vehicle.lift_goods()
2. 物联网技术
物联网技术在智慧物流中的应用日益凸显。通过将物流设备、运输车辆等接入物联网,实现实时数据采集、传输和分析,提高物流管理效率。以下是一个简单的物联网技术应用示例:
# 假设有一个物流设备,我们需要将其接入物联网,实现实时数据采集
import requests
class LogisticsDevice:
def __init__(self, device_id):
self.device_id = device_id
def collect_data(self):
# 采集设备数据
data = {'device_id': self.device_id, 'temperature': 25, 'humidity': 50}
response = requests.post('http://iotapi.com/collect_data', json=data)
return response.json()
device = LogisticsDevice('device_001')
data = device.collect_data()
print('设备数据:', data)
3. 人工智能算法
人工智能算法在智慧物流中的应用不断拓展。通过深度学习、强化学习等算法,实现智能调度、预测分析等功能,提高物流运营效率。以下是一个简单的智能调度示例:
# 假设有一个物流公司,我们需要利用人工智能算法实现智能调度
import numpy as np
def schedule_tasks(tasks, algorithm='q-learning'):
# 实现智能调度
if algorithm == 'q-learning':
# 使用Q-learning算法
q_table = np.zeros((len(tasks), len(tasks)))
for i in range(len(tasks)):
for j in range(len(tasks)):
if i != j:
q_table[i][j] = 1
# ...(此处省略Q-learning算法的具体实现)
elif algorithm == 'deep_q_network':
# 使用深度Q网络算法
# ...(此处省略DQN算法的具体实现)
return q_table
tasks = ['task_1', 'task_2', 'task_3']
q_table = schedule_tasks(tasks)
print('调度结果:', q_table)
总结
智慧物流作为物流行业与前沿技术的深度融合,正推动着行业变革。大模型在智慧物流中的应用,以及最新智能物流技术的突破,为物流行业带来了前所未有的发展机遇。未来,随着技术的不断进步,智慧物流将更加高效、智能,为我们的生活带来更多便利。
